当前位置: 首页 > news >正文

告别图片格式烦恼:Chrome右键菜单的格式转换神器

告别图片格式烦恼:Chrome右键菜单的格式转换神器

【免费下载链接】Save-Image-as-TypeSave Image as Type is an chrome extension which add Save as PNG / JPG / WebP to the context menu of image.项目地址: https://gitcode.com/gh_mirrors/sa/Save-Image-as-Type

你有没有遇到过这样的情况?在网上找到一张完美的图片素材,想要下载使用,却发现它是WebP格式,而你需要的却是JPG或PNG。或者你需要一个带透明背景的PNG图片,但网站只提供JPG格式下载。这些看似简单的格式转换问题,却常常打断你的工作流程,让你不得不打开额外的软件或访问在线转换网站。

今天我要介绍的就是一个能让你彻底告别这些烦恼的Chrome扩展——Save Image as Type。这个工具的理念非常简单:让图片格式转换变得像右键点击一样简单。无需离开浏览器,无需安装额外软件,更不需要上传图片到第三方服务器,所有操作都在你的电脑本地完成。

一个设计师的真实故事

小张是一位UI设计师,每天需要在网上寻找各种设计素材。他经常遇到这样的困扰:

"上周我为一个客户设计网页,需要下载一些图标素材。网站上的图标都是WebP格式,但我的设计软件需要PNG格式。每次下载后,我都要用Photoshop打开再另存为PNG,重复操作浪费了大量时间。直到我发现了Save Image as Type,现在只需要右键点击,选择'另存为PNG',一切就完成了。"

这个扩展的魔力就在于它无缝集成到Chrome的右键菜单中。当你安装后,在任何网页图片上右键点击,都会看到新增的"图片另存为JPG/PNG/WebP"选项。点击这个选项,就会展开三个具体格式的选择:

  • PNG格式:完美保留透明背景,适合图标、Logo和设计素材
  • JPG格式:智能压缩,在保证质量的同时减小文件体积
  • WebP格式:现代网页标准格式,兼顾高质量和小文件大小

技术实现:轻量而强大

你可能好奇这个扩展是如何工作的。让我简单介绍一下它的技术架构:

核心文件结构

  • manifest.json- 扩展配置文件,定义了权限和基本信息
  • background.js- 后台服务脚本,处理右键菜单逻辑
  • _locales/- 多语言支持文件夹,包含13种语言翻译
  • offscreen.htmloffscreen.js- 处理图片转换的离屏文档

工作原理

  1. 当你在图片上右键点击时,扩展捕获图片的原始数据
  2. 使用HTML5 Canvas技术将图片转换为目标格式
  3. 所有处理都在浏览器本地完成,不经过任何远程服务器
  4. 转换完成后直接触发浏览器下载

这种设计确保了:

  • 隐私安全:你的图片数据永远不会离开你的电脑
  • 处理速度:本地转换比上传到云端快得多
  • 离线可用:没有网络也能正常使用

安装方式:两种选择任你挑选

从Chrome应用商店安装(最简单)

如果你想要最稳定的版本,可以直接从Chrome应用商店搜索"Save Image as Type"安装。这是最推荐的方式,扩展会自动更新,兼容性也最好。

手动安装开发版本(最新功能)

如果你想体验最新功能,或者想要了解扩展的内部工作原理,可以手动安装:

git clone https://gitcode.com/gh_mirrors/sa/Save-Image-as-Type

然后在Chrome中打开扩展管理页面(chrome://extensions/),开启"开发者模式",点击"加载已解压的扩展程序",选择刚才克隆的项目文件夹即可。

实际使用场景:不只是格式转换

这个扩展的价值远不止简单的格式转换。让我分享几个实际的使用场景:

场景一:内容创作者的工作流程

"我是一名自媒体创作者,每天需要处理大量图片。以前我需要在不同的格式之间来回转换,现在有了这个扩展,我可以在下载时直接选择最适合平台的格式——JPG用于社交媒体,PNG用于需要透明背景的图片,WebP用于网页优化。"

场景二:学生的作业辅助

"孩子做作业需要从网上找图片,但下载的格式常常打不开。现在我可以教他直接右键选择正确的格式,再也不用担心格式兼容性问题了。"

场景三:开发者的效率工具

"作为前端开发者,我需要下载各种网页素材进行测试。这个扩展让我能快速获取不同格式的图片,测试网页在不同格式下的加载性能。"

格式选择的最佳实践

虽然扩展支持三种格式的互相转换,但了解每种格式的特点能帮助你做出更好的选择:

什么时候选择PNG?

  • 需要透明背景时(图标、Logo、水印)
  • 图片包含文字或线条图形
  • 对图片质量要求极高,可以接受较大的文件大小

什么时候选择JPG?

  • 照片类图片,特别是色彩丰富的照片
  • 需要较小的文件大小进行分享或上传
  • 不需要透明背景的普通图片

什么时候选择WebP?

  • 用于网页优化,追求加载速度
  • 同时需要较好的质量和较小的文件大小
  • 现代浏览器环境下的使用场景

扩展的独特优势

与其他图片转换工具相比,Save Image as Type有几个明显的优势:

完全免费且开源基于GPL v2许可证开源,你可以完全免费使用,甚至可以根据需要修改源代码。所有代码都公开在项目中,没有任何隐藏功能或收费计划。

多语言支持扩展支持13种语言,包括英语、中文、日语、韩语、俄语、法语、德语、西班牙语等。系统会自动检测你的浏览器语言并显示相应的界面。

兼容性广泛支持Chrome 88及以上版本,也兼容所有基于Chromium的浏览器,如Edge、Brave等。无论你使用哪个浏览器,都能获得一致的体验。

轻量级设计整个扩展只有几个核心文件,不会占用太多系统资源,也不会影响浏览器的运行速度。

常见问题解答

Q: 扩展会影响浏览器性能吗?A: 完全不会。扩展只在右键点击图片时激活,平时处于休眠状态,对浏览器性能几乎没有影响。

Q: 转换后的图片质量会下降吗?A: 扩展会尽量保持原始图片质量。JPG格式采用智能压缩算法,在文件大小和画质之间取得平衡;PNG格式是无损保存;WebP格式使用现代压缩技术。

Q: 支持批量转换吗?A: 目前不支持批量转换,但你可以结合Chrome的多标签页功能,在不同标签页中分别处理多张图片。

Q: 需要联网使用吗?A: 完全不需要。所有处理都在本地完成,即使在离线状态下也能正常使用。

开始使用吧

现在你已经了解了Save Image as Type的所有优势。无论你是设计师、内容创作者、开发者,还是普通用户,这个扩展都能为你带来实实在在的便利。

安装后你会发现,处理网页图片变得如此简单:右键点击 → 选择格式 → 保存完成。整个过程不到3秒,真正实现了"所想即所得"的极致体验。

告别复杂的图片格式转换流程,让Save Image as Type成为你浏览器中的得力助手。你会发现,原来解决图片格式问题可以如此简单直接,就像它本应如此一样。

【免费下载链接】Save-Image-as-TypeSave Image as Type is an chrome extension which add Save as PNG / JPG / WebP to the context menu of image.项目地址: https://gitcode.com/gh_mirrors/sa/Save-Image-as-Type

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/695576/

相关文章:

  • 配置windows定时自动重启
  • 用MATLAB复现SS-MUSIC算法:从相干信号处理到DOA估计实战(附完整代码)
  • 基于Intel 8088 CPU控制LCM4002A字符型液晶的驱动程序
  • C++ MCP网关延迟突增23ms?别再查业务逻辑了——从RDTSC时间戳校准到Intel RAPL功耗反推,定位硬件级性能陷阱
  • 32位单片机时代再看8051单片机诞生的开创性的意义
  • WiFi 7国内受限:值不值得买?
  • VSCode搜索变慢、Git状态延迟、IntelliSense失灵?这不是Bug——是配置级性能灾难(附一键检测脚本)
  • 寄快递被多收钱?90%的人不知道,钱花在哪里了
  • 信息论在机器学习中的应用与实践
  • 2026年推荐几家哈尔滨设备回收/哈尔滨废旧设备回收品牌公司推荐 - 品牌宣传支持者
  • Python 元类编程:高级技巧与应用
  • REFramework深度解析:RE引擎游戏Mod开发的架构设计与实践方案
  • 【C++高吞吐MCP网关实战白皮书】:20年SRE亲授生产级部署的7大避坑铁律与压测达标标准
  • Centos7 永久禁 ping永久禁用 ping
  • 企业级自托管 CRM 推荐(支持 RBAC、AI 和 API)
  • Python实现K近邻算法:从原理到实战应用
  • 人生无处不下注:你早就在赌桌上了
  • IDA远程调试Linux ELF实战:从环境搭建到网络排障全解析
  • 不平衡分类问题的采样方法与应用实践
  • 2026年OpenClaw部署新手教程
  • Java智能地址解析架构方案:企业级数据治理的技术实现原理
  • Agent Laboratory:模块化AI研究助理框架,自动化文献、实验与报告全流程
  • 2026年自配送平台技术解析与优质服务商参考 - 优质品牌商家
  • 【前端圭臬】一:写给入坑前端的你
  • 数据驱动决策:商业与技术的融合实践
  • 为什么你的LangChain+LlamaIndex调试总失败?——VSCode多智能体调试黄金配置(含3个已验证的launch.json生产级范例)
  • WMS 2026版深度解析:从成本优化到全链路数字化仓储升级路径
  • 机器学习数据预处理:鲁棒缩放技术解析与实践
  • Python 内置数据结构性能对比基础
  • XGBoost在Apple Silicon上的编译安装与优化指南